Question - Pie Corporation acquired 70 percent of Slice Company's common stock on December 31, 20X5, at underlying book value. The book values and fair values of Slice's assets and liabilities were equal, and the fair value of the noncontrolling interest was equal to 30 percent of the total book value of Slice. Slice provided the following trial balance data at December 31, 20X5:

Debit Credit

Cash $27,400

Accounts Receivable 64,150

Inventory 90,200

Buildings and Equipment (net) 216,000

Cost of Goods Sold 103,300

Depreciation Expense 23,600

Other Operating Expenses 30,620

Dividends Declared 15,900

Accounts Payable $33,680

Notes Payable 121,000

Common Stock 95,400

Retained Earnings 130,000

Sales 191,090

Total $571,170 $571,170

Required -

a. How much did Pie pay to purchase its shares of Slice?

b. If consolidated financial statements are prepared at December 31, 20X5, what amount will be assigned to the non-controlling interest in the consolidated balance sheet?

c. If Pie reported income of $141,750 from its separate operations for 20X5, what amount of consolidated net income will be reported for 20X5?

d. If Pie had purchased its ownership of Slice on January 1, 20X5, at underlying book value and Pie reported income of $141,750 from its separate operations for 20X5, what amount of consolidated net income would be reported for 20X5?
